GONASER

Action

Estrous induction and synchronization. Anestrous treatment.

Highly purified Serum gonadotropin (eCG), as lyophilized powder and solvent for dilution.

Composition:

GONASER 500: vial containing 500 IU of eCG-PMSG as lyophilized powder. Vial containing 5 mL of solvent for dilution (PBS).

GONASER 5000: vial containing 5,000 IU of eCG-PMSG as lyophilized powder. Vial containing 50 mL of solvent for dilution (PBS).

Target Species:

Cattle, sheep and goats.

Indications:

Estrous induction and synchronization. Ovulation induction (anestrous treatment).

Administration route:

Intramuscular.

Recommendations for use and dosage:

CATTLE: 300 – 400 IU/animal, equivalent to 3 to 4 mL of the final dilution. SHEEP and GOATS: 400 – 600 IU/animal, equivalent to 4 to 6 mL of the final dilution; most frequently used dose = 500 UI (5 mL).

Administer as a single dose at the end of estrous synchronization protocol.

The lyophilized must be reconstituted using the entire volume of the solvent for GONASER. Final concentration after full reconstitution is 100 IU/ mL.

Withdrawal period:

Meat: 0 days | Milk: 0 hours; 0 days.

Storage:

Refrigerated 2-8 ºC. Keep lyophilized vial protected from sunlight.
